What are the responsibilities and job description for the Business Intelligence Analyst (Brazil) position at Hyland Software, Inc.?
Overview
-
The Business Intelligence Analyst is responsible for understanding business/department needs and goals and creating data-driven analysis and insight to support management decisions.
What you will be doing
- Provide data and reporting for analyses on relating to business needs gathered from key internal business stakeholders.
- Create and analyze monthly executive management reports
- Query data warehouses and create standard ad hoc reports for end users using spreadsheets, macros, and reporting writing tools
- Provide end user training. Provide training and guidance on how to interpret and apply data
- Perform and analyze data integrity audits
- Collaborate with key stakeholders to determine requirements and participate projects that generated required intelligence with general oversight
- Assist with training new analysts on internal processes, data warehouse use, reporting and data infrastructure
- Administer reporting portal including page design, security, report libraries, and content additions, revisions and deletions
